Silicon Valley and Wall Street are experiencing a wave of panic regarding Chinese artificial intelligence developments. The specific catalyst for this market anxiety is Moonshot AI and its Kimi model.

Market observers recently discussed this phenomenon on the Equity podcast. The conversation centred on why this particular Chinese artificial intelligence entity has managed to unsettle established American technology hubs and financial centres.

The reaction from Wall Street and Silicon Valley underscores the intense competitive pressure within the global artificial intelligence sector. Moonshot AI has clearly demonstrated enough capability with Kimi to trigger serious concern among major industry stakeholders and investors.
